While focus groups are helpful to reference at the start of new product or campaign development, they’re less useful for gathering customer feedback once said post-launch. Social media is much cheaper than surveys or focus groups, which can cost thousands of dollars depending on the size and complexity of your research panel.

Social media is the world’s largest and most transparent focus group. Social listening lets you tap into that focus group, their conversations and the trends happening not just around your brand, but around your industry as a whole.
